Beardlip Penstemon belongs to the family Scrophulariaceae and African Daisy belongs to the family Asteraceae.

Also, when you compare Beardlip Penstemon and African Daisy,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Penstemon and other plant's genus is Osteospermum. Beardlip Penstemon tribe is Not Available and African Daisy tribe is Calenduleae. Beardlip Penstemon clade is Angiosperms, Asterids, Dicotyledonous and Eudicots and order is Lamiales whereas African Daisy clade is Angiosperms, Asterids and Eudicots and order is Asterales. Every plant have subfamilies. Beardlip Penstemon subfamilies are, Not Available and African Daisy subfamilies are Asteroideae.
